WebApr 11, 2024 · Backpacking and Camping Several Trails in Point Reyes lead to designated campsites where backpackers can enjoy a night or two in this coastal wilderness. Our goal is to make a 2-night trip here in the near future. The trails leading to campsites are up to 6.7 miles long, with others being much shorter.

WebOct 26, 2024 · Point Reyes has many trails and campsites, but I'll be giving an overview of a one-night backpacking trip I've been on to Glen Camp and a general "how-to" go about making reservations to backpack here. Day 1. Day 2. STATS. Date: 4.16.17 - 4.17.17 ... It is important to note that there is NO dispersed camping allowed in Point Reyes. You … WebTo make reservations for a Trail Camp go to, www.recreation.gov. Day 1. Your first day begins with picking up your permit at the Bear Valley Visitor Center in Point Reyes. They open at 9 am on weekends, and 10 am on …
